The Decline of Otago Rugby and the Stadium

The current low state of Otago Rugby has consequences for the viability of the proposed new Stadium. Its operating budget relies on large crowds going to Super14 and NPC matches. The projected Operating Budget is based on Carisbrook crowds up to 2006. It is no secret Carisbrook crowd numbers have collapsed over the last two years, but the actual figures do seem to be secret. At the end of last year in a letter to the ODT, I asked for these figures (for last year), but the Carisbrook Stadium Trust declined the ODT's request to provide them.
I believe that the paid attendance figures for Super 14 and NPC matches at Carisbrook in 2007 and 2008 should be made publicly available. Then there can be a debate about what are realistic figures to be used in Stadium's operating budget. I have no doubt that using this year's figures would result in a significant deficit.
